The expression and significance of P-gp, MRP and C-erbB-2 in tissues of breast cancer

Objective:To investigate the expression of P-gp、MRP and C-erbB-2 in breast cancer as well as the correlation between expression and clinical pathological characteristics.Methods:Examined the expression of P-gp、MRP and C-erbB-2 in 52 cases of the breast carcinomas and 40 cases of the normal breast tissues with the immunohistochemical technique(S-P method).Results:(1) The positive rate of P-gp and C-erbB-2 in tissues of breast cancer was higher than that in the normal breast tissues (P0.01), there was no significant difference for the expression of MDR between tissues of breast camer and those of normal breasts(P0.05). (2) There was no significant difference for the expression of P-gp, MDR among tissues of breast cancer with various kinds of pathological characteristics(P0.05); The positive rate of C-erbB-2 was statistically higher in tissues of breast cancer with metastasis in lymph nodes than those without metastasis in lymph nodes(P0.01).(3) P-gP expression is significantly higher in C-erbB-2 positive cases than in C-erbB-2 negative cases(P0.05).Conclusion: The higher expression of P-gp may participate the primary mechanism of drug fast in breast cancer, excluding that of MDR,C-erbB-2 may induce and elevate the expression of P-gp in breast carcinomas tissue.
